Description of bls.gov
bls.gov appears to be the official website of the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, a federal agency within the United States Department of Labor. The homepage shown in the scan features labor-market news releases, inflation and employment statistics, publications, data tools, and regional economic information, which is consistent with a government data and research portal.
Based on the domain, page branding, and classification data, the site serves as a public resource for labor economics, employment figures, wage data, price indexes, and related statistical publications. The long-established .gov domain and visible federal government identifiers suggest it is operated by a U.S. government entity rather than a private commercial organization.
Safety Assessment for bls.gov
The available scan results are strongly reassuring at the time of this scan. The domain was not flagged by any of 91 security engines, the malware scan reported no flagged files, and the checked blacklist and threat-database entries were clean. Multiple web-classification sources also categorized the site as government or job-search related, which aligns with the visible content and branding.
Additional context also supports a low-risk assessment: the domain has been registered for many years, uses a signed DNSSEC configuration, and presents as an official government information portal rather than a storefront, login lure, or download-heavy page. No suspicious external-link activity, iframe usage, or malware indicators were reported in the supplied scan data.
Based on available data, no threats were detected at the time of this scan.
Technical Description
The site uses a valid SSL/TLS certificate issued by Entrust Limited, with expiry extending to 2027-03-22. It resolves to 146.142.252.23, is served through AkamaiGHost infrastructure, and the hosting is identified as Bureau of Labor Statistics in Washington, United States. These details are consistent with a large public-sector web deployment using content-delivery or edge-serving infrastructure.
From a domain-security perspective, the WHOIS record indicates the domain was created in 1997 and remains active through 2026. DNSSEC is enabled and signed, which may help protect against certain DNS-manipulation risks. No immediate technical security concerns were indicated in the provided scan results, although the exact supported TLS protocol versions were not listed.
